DGFT’s new website to go live today

Ludhiana, August 27

The new website of the Directorate General of Foreign Trade (DGFT) (trade.gov.in) will go live on August 28. The new website will be carry information for exporters, including about new foreign markets and products as well as the facility of contact with the Indian consulates.

In this regard, the government has ordered all the agencies of the country to issue old pending certificates before August 28.

A meeting of all the agencies issuing Certificate of Origin to the exporters was held with the officials of the directorate. In the meeting, it was informed that exporters would have to register on the new website to get the Certificate of Origin after August 28. The certificate is mandatory for exporters to export to most countries. The issuing process became online in 2021. These certificates are of preferential and non-preferential category.

FOPSIA president Badish Jindal said all the exporters had been informed about the new website. The registered associations of the Ministry of Commerce will also be register themselves on the new website and approve these applications. For this, Aadhaar authentication will now be mandatory instead of digital signatures.
